Major Palm Beach County, Florida Real Estate Markets

The county's real estate activity centers around several distinct metropolitan areas, each with unique characteristics and price points. West Palm Beach anchors the urban core with its revitalized downtown, luxury condominiums, and growing tech sector, while coastal communities like Delray Beach, Boca Raton, and Jupiter command premium prices for their beachfront properties and resort-style amenities. Wellington has emerged as a premier equestrian destination, attracting international buyers seeking horse properties and polo club memberships.

Surprising growth has occurred in previously overlooked areas like Lake Worth, Boynton Beach, and Greenacres, where younger buyers and investors are discovering value plays close to major employment centers. The western communities of Royal Palm Beach, Loxahatchee, and Belle Glade offer more affordable options while still providing access to the county's amenities, creating diverse opportunities for agents specializing in different market segments and buyer demographics.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Palm Beach County's real estate market operates across dramatically different geographic zones, from barrier islands with strict development limitations to inland areas experiencing rapid suburban expansion. Seasonal fluctuations significantly impact inventory and pricing, with winter months bringing an influx of international and out-of-state buyers who drive up competition for premium properties. The county's appeal to retirees, families, and young professionals creates multiple submarkets operating simultaneously with different price pressures and inventory challenges.

Climate resilience has become an increasingly important factor, with buyers paying premiums for properties with hurricane-resistant construction and flood mitigation features. The market has also seen surprising strength in luxury rural properties, as remote work trends allow buyers to choose larger lots and custom homes in previously less desirable western areas, fundamentally reshaping traditional real estate value propositions throughout the region.
